Quantitative geomorphology of drainage basins in Sumter National Forest involves the study and measurement of the physical features and processes of the forest's drainage basins, focusing on aspects such as landforms, sediment transport, and hydrology.
Researchers, environmental consultants, and agencies involved in land management and environmental assessments related to the Sumter National Forest may be required to file quantitative geomorphology studies.
To fill out the quantitative geomorphology assessment, one should collect relevant data on the watershed characteristics, such as topography, soil type, and hydrological patterns, and then input this information according to the specified format or template provided by the relevant authority.
The purpose is to understand the geomorphological dynamics of the drainage basins, inform conservation efforts, and manage resources effectively within the Sumter National Forest.
Key information includes drainage area dimensions, slope gradients, sediment characteristics, land use patterns, hydrological data, and any observations related to erosion or sedimentation processes.
